Britten-Norman is seeking a Production Director who is highly skilled and experienced in aerospace manufacturing and also passionate, inspirational, and driven to lead a dynamic team in the production of new aircraft, parts, and associated engineering support activities.

This is a pivotal role within our organisation, offering a unique opportunity to deliver UK-built aircraft from our newly re-patriated production line, and be a part of aviation history. As we embark on this exciting new chapter, you will be instrumental in overseeing the highest standards of quality, safety, and efficiency across all manufacturing operations.

Britten-Norman is the producer of one of the most successful civil aircraft ever manufactured in the UK and is now the UK’s only independent civil aircraft manufacturer. We are also a leading aerospace SME, offering a market leading range of aviation related services internationally.

Key Responsibilities

The successful candidate will have a vision for continuous improvement, a deep commitment to operational excellence, and a clear focus on customer satisfaction. As Production Director, you will lead the manufacturing process from the initial design stage through to the final delivery of aircraft and parts, overseeing all production operations while fostering a positive, inclusive, and collaborative company culture.

You will be expected to drive change, embrace innovation, and improve both internal processes and employee development. We are looking for a leader who can inspire teams, instil a shared sense of purpose, and motivate the workforce to achieve ambitious manufacturing and performance goals. You should thrive in a fast-paced, results-oriented environment, be passionate about developing and mentoring talent, and be determined to ensure our products meet the highest industry standards.

The Production Director will be responsible for ensuring compliance to Part 21G regulation across all activities and be able to hold the Form 4 position for the approval.
